Janet Jackson still can’t listen to Jacko’s songs
April 1st, 2010 - 8:53 pm ICT by IANS
London, April 1(IANS) Singer Janet Jackson has revealed that she is still struggling over her brother Michael Jackson’s death and can’t listen to the late pop star’s music.
“I couldn’t listen to my brother’s music. That’s still hard for me to do. Or to see a picture,” reports contactmusic.com quoted her as saying.
The singer-actress confesses she has been avoiding all of Michael’s songs because it’s too painful to hear his voice or see his face in photos.
